Heavy periods, pelvic pain, and painful cramps shouldn’t be ignored.

While adenomyosis and endometriosis share similar symptoms, they are different conditions that require proper evaluation and diagnosis.

Our latest blog explains the key differences between endometriosis and adenomyosis, common symptoms to watch for, and when to schedule a visit with your OB/GYN for personalized treatment options.

Early awareness leads to better outcomes.
